Revelation 2: 4-5



What I heard from Jesus today is: If Ephesus could fall, you also will!

I would like you to read Acts 19: 1 - 20: 38 to remind yourself of how Paul established perhaps the strongest church in Early Church and that is the church of Ephesus. Paul, in his second missionary, found the lecture hall of Tyrannus and started the first training school for missionaries. Most of the first batch of missionaries in the Early Church were from this school. You can also see how intimate and close was Paul to the leaders of Ephesus.

But, many years later, John gave them a message to call them to repent because they forsaken their first love. What really happened? What does that means by forsaken of their first love? I am quite sure it means the daily intimate personal relationship with Jesus, the micro stage of discipleship development! I have seen too many clergy and leaders including myself felt into this trap strategically set by the Deceiver. More study, more work, more service, more... might not help you to be more closer to Christ doing His Kingdom work! It's the being not the doing my friend! Don't step into the "doing" trap. With the "being" you will know and bear an example of the "doing". Without the "being" you will become a dangerous weapon to be used by the Deceiver to destroy God's servants and His works! Watch out my dear brothers and sisters!

If the church of Ephesus could fall, you and I are will fall sooner or later unless we do not lose our first love to Jesus!

Welcome! The purpose of this blog is to encourage Christians to have daily devotion - a wonderful and intimate time with Jesus.


There are three reasons for you to use this blog as your daily devotion:
1. A healthy spiritual diet - One chapter of the Bible daily. We really need at least one chapter of Bible daily so that we are well fed.

2. A good example of Spiritual Journaling - What I have committed for 1,189 days(the Bible has 1,189 chapters)to write this daily post is not for teaching purposes but this is my daily spiritual journal - I write down what I hear from Jesus and how I experience His intimate relationship with me each day. I have launched a wide-spectrum research on daily devotion and have found out that there are less than 10% of Christians that are having daily devotion. Out of that 10%, many having daily devotion are doing so because of guilt (they know that they are Christians and need to have daily devotion and feel guilty if they don’t do that), duty (they need to fulfill their duty as a Christian) or study(lots of Christians primarily use their daily devotion as a time to study the Bible). I do pray and hope that you will make up your mind to have a relational daily devotion so that you can have an intimate time with Jesus. I pray that you will write your own spiritual journal as well.

3. An online discipler – One of the reasons that so many Christians do not have daily devotion is because they do not have a disciple. A discipler can help them build up this basic element of discipleship when they first become Christians. The best way for you is to have a discipler to walk with you for a certain period of time so that daily devotion become a good habit. Or, you may have a small group of two to three people to encourage and be accountable to each other so that you won’t stop your daily devotion. To Jesus Christ who loves us and has freed us from our sins by his blood, and has made us to be a kingdom and priests to serve his God and Father - to him be glory and power for ever and ever! Amen. Revelation 1: 5-6


Most Christians are so familiar with the Lord's Prayer and we often say "May your Kingdom come" so easily without thinking whether we really mean it. This morning when I was looking out the window of Michelle's ward at 7a.m. during my daily devotion, I cried out to our Heavenly Father, "May your Kingdom come!" I took a picture of the beautiful scene of the beautiful sunlight showering down the far east side of Vancouver. You can see Vancouver City Hall right in front and the Science Centre on the left hand side. If any bad thing happens to Michelle, do I have the faith to cry out, "May your Kingdom come!" Life is always full of challenges reminding where we really are.

What John was called to tell the seven churches and us can be so simple: The end of the world or the end of your life is coming, where are you? Have your sins be washed by Jesus so that you are in God's Kingdom and Jesus is your Lord? Are you in His Kingdom right now, knowing how to listen and obey to your King? Have you obediently fulfill the call to be 'priests' to bring other people into His Kingdom and serve the Lord with all your heart, with all your mind and with all your soul? But, is that really so simple? Scholars for centuries have been trying their best to solve the "code" of the book of Revelation. Thinking that if they can solve it, then they can know the future. If you are in a true daily relationship with Jesus, then the present is so intimate and the future is so secure. May your Kingdom come!
